>웹 프론트엔드 >uni-app >uniapp 소스 코드 수정

uniapp 소스 코드 수정

WBOY
WBOY원래의
2023-05-22 09:24:361811검색

최근에는 모바일 인터넷의 급속한 발전으로 인해 모바일 애플리케이션 개발이 점점 더 많은 개발자의 관심사가 되었습니다. 이어서 다양한 공통 프런트엔드 프레임워크가 등장했습니다. Uniapp은 Vue.js를 기반으로 하는 크로스 플랫폼 프레임워크로, 동일한 코드를 사용하여 iOS, Android 및 H5 플랫폼용 애플리케이션을 빠르게 개발할 수 있습니다. Uniapp은 WeChat 미니 프로그램, Alipay 미니 프로그램, Baidu 스마트 미니 프로그램의 실행 환경을 통합하여 다양한 미니 프로그램의 실행 환경을 기본 환경에서 웹 환경으로 전환하기 때문입니다.

그러나 Uniapp의 기본 스타일과 기능은 모든 애플리케이션 개발 요구 사항에 적합하지 않을 수 있습니다. 따라서 맞춤형 스타일과 기능이 필요한 일부 애플리케이션의 경우 Uniapp의 소스 코드를 수정해야 할 수도 있습니다. 이번 글에서는 Uniapp의 소스코드를 수정하는 방법을 소개하겠습니다.

1. 준비

유니앱 소스코드 수정을 시작하기 전, 몇 가지 기본 지식을 이해해야 합니다. 첫 번째는 Vue.js에 대한 기본 지식입니다. Vue.js 공식 문서를 참고하여 학습할 수 있습니다. 둘째, 일반적으로 사용되는 CSS 스타일과 JavaScript 구문을 충분히 숙지해야 합니다. 마지막으로 Node.js 및 Git 도구를 설치해야 합니다. Node.js는 Chrome V8 엔진 기반의 JavaScript 실행 환경으로, 브라우저 외부에서 JavaScript를 실행할 수 있으며, Git은 소스 코드의 수정 내역을 기록하는 데 도움을 주는 버전 제어 도구입니다.

2. 소스 코드 수정

  1. Uniapp 소스 코드 풀기

먼저 명령줄 인터페이스에서 프로젝트의 루트 디렉터리를 입력하고(또는 프로젝트의 루트 디렉터리로 새 폴더를 생성) 사용합니다. Uniapp의 소스 코드를 가져오는 Git 도구입니다. 명령은 다음과 같습니다:

git clone https://github.com/dcloudio/uni-app.git
  1. 스타일 수정

Uniapp에서 각 페이지는 vue 파일과 해당 스타일 파일(보통 .less 또는 .scss 파일)로 구성됩니다. 스타일을 수정해야 하는 경우 해당 스타일 파일을 직접 수정한 다음 스타일 파일을 vue 파일에 도입할 수 있습니다.

  1. 구성 요소 수정

구성 요소를 수정해야 하는 경우 먼저 해당 구성 요소 파일을 찾아야 합니다. Uniapp에서 각 구성 요소는 일반적으로 src/comComponents 디렉터리에 저장되는 별도의 파일입니다. 수정해야 할 파일을 찾은 후 직접 수정하면 됩니다.

  1. 플러그인 수정

플러그인을 수정해야 한다면 먼저 플러그인 사용법을 이해해야 합니다. Uniapp에서는 플러그인이 npm 패키지로 설치되어 사용됩니다. 따라서 플러그인을 수정해야 하는 경우 먼저 package.json 파일에서 해당 플러그인 종속성을 찾은 다음 npm 명령을 사용하여 해당 종속성 패키지를 설치해야 합니다. 설치가 완료된 후 node_modules 디렉터리에서 해당 플러그인의 소스 코드를 직접 수정할 수 있습니다.

  1. 유니앱 소스코드 수정

위 방법 중 어느 것도 수정 요구 사항을 충족할 수 없는 경우 유니앱 소스 코드를 직접 수정할 수 있습니다. 수정 방법은 기본적으로 Node.js 프로젝트와 동일합니다. 먼저 명령줄 인터페이스에 Uniapp의 루트 디렉터리를 입력한 다음 npm 명령을 사용하여 프로젝트 종속성을 설치합니다.

npm install

설치가 완료된 후 코드를 직접 수정할 수 있습니다. 수정 결과를 확인해야 하는 경우 npm 명령을 사용하여 개발 서버를 시작할 수 있습니다.

npm run dev

시작한 후 브라우저에서 http://localhost:8080을 방문하여 미리 볼 수 있습니다.

3. 수정 사항 제출

수정을 완료한 후 수정된 결과를 코드 저장소에 제출해야 합니다. 먼저 Uniapp 루트 디렉터리에 있는 Git 도구를 사용하여 수정된 코드를 로컬 저장소에 추가합니다.

git add .

그런 다음 commit 명령을 사용하여 수정 사항을 제출합니다.

git commit -m "修改说明"

마지막으로 push 명령을 사용하여 코드를 저장소에 푸시합니다. 원격 저장소를 제출하면 완료됩니다.

git push origin master

4. 요약

위 단계를 통해 Uniapp의 소스 코드를 쉽게 수정할 수 있습니다. 소스코드를 수정하면 코드의 안정성과 유지관리성에 영향을 미칠 수 있으므로, 수정하기 전에 수정에 따른 영향을 주의깊게 평가하고, 수정 전 코드가 복원될 수 있도록 백업 작업을 하셔야 합니다. 문제가 발생하면 제 시간에. 동시에 Uniapp은 Vue.js를 기반으로 하는 크로스 플랫폼 프레임워크이므로 소스 코드를 수정할 때 Vue.js의 사양과 디자인 아이디어를 따라야 수정된 코드와 원본 프레임워크의 호환성을 보장할 수 있습니다.

위 내용은 uniapp 소스 코드 수정의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

성명:
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.